Why Drupal is the ideal platform for charities and non-profits

Joe Pilgrim

on

Charities, non-governmental organisations (NGOs), and non-profits face a unique challenge: they need enterprise-grade digital platforms to inspire action and manage critical operations, yet they must achieve this within limited budgets and resources.

Drupal delivers the best of both worlds — offering the scalability, flexibility, and security of a world-class CMS, without the prohibitive costs of proprietary software. For mission-driven organisations that depend on trust, efficiency, and meaningful connections, Drupal is the platform that empowers them to thrive.

Cost-effectiveness and open source

For non-profits, every penny counts. Choosing Drupal means you avoid expensive licensing fees while still benefiting from a platform that rivals (and often surpasses) commercial alternatives.

  • No licensing costs – Drupal is completely open source, removing a significant financial barrier.
  • Active global community – Thousands of contributors worldwide continuously improve the platform.
  • Lower total cost of ownership – With no recurring licence expenses and flexibility in hosting, Drupal reduces long-term costs compared to proprietary systems.

The result? More of your budget can go where it matters most — advancing your mission.

Learn more about our Drupal development services and how we deliver cost-effective solutions.

Scalability for growth

Your digital needs today may not be the same tomorrow. Drupal’s flexible architecture means it can evolve with your organisation.

  • Launch small campaign microsites quickly and affordably.
  • Scale to global, multi-site charity portals without compromising performance.
  • Seamlessly integrate with fundraising platforms, CRMs, and donation tools.

This scalability ensures your digital presence grows in step with your impact.

Security and compliance

Trust is essential for non-profits, especially when handling sensitive supporter data. Drupal is built with enterprise-level security at its core.

  • Dedicated security team provides ongoing monitoring and rapid response to emerging threats.
  • Compliance-ready architecture helps meet strict data protection standards and charity regulations.

With Drupal, you can protect the trust your supporters place in you.

Talk to one of our digital experts

Alex Farr

Principal Developer

Looking to unlock the full potential of your Drupal platform?

At Box UK, Alex specialises in innovative technical solutions and Proof of Concept generation — from Drupal rescue projects to bespoke IoT development and AI/Machine Learning applications.

Recently, Alex led successful AI/ML proof of concept then build projects for an engineering client, developing neural networks, random forests, and similarity search algorithms to automate design workflows and streamline complex technical processes, bringing together his deep technical expertise and collaborative approach to deliver measurable impact.

Or call us on 020 7439 1900

Accessibility and inclusivity

Every visitor to your site matters — whether they’re a potential donor, a beneficiary, or a volunteer. Drupal’s accessibility-first approach ensures your digital experiences are inclusive by design.

  • Core accessibility features support compliance with WCAG standards.
  • Tools and templates make it easier to create content that everyone can use.

For charities, this inclusivity isn’t just a requirement — it’s part of the mission.

Mobile-friendly experiences that drive action

TAs supporters increasingly use phones to engage with charities for donations, event sign-ups, or ticket purchases, Drupal’s mobile-first design provides a seamless and intuitive experience across all devices. This frictionless interaction encourages people to act on their goodwill from anywhere.

  • Seamless Mobile Experience: Drupal’s mobile-first design ensures your website functions flawlessly on any device.
  • Reduced Friction: Easy-to-use mobile interfaces remove barriers to engagement.
  • Increased Action: Intuitive design makes it simpler for supporters to donate, sign up, or purchase tickets on the go.

Community engagement tools

Connecting with your audience is at the heart of nonprofit success. Drupal gives you powerful tools to build meaningful relationships.

  • Personalised content to engage donors and supporters with relevant messages.
  • Multi-language support to communicate across regions and cultures.
  • Flexible publishing workflows to empower teams to create and share content quickly.

These capabilities help you inspire action, strengthen loyalty, and extend your reach.

Box UK’s experience and value

At Box UK, we’ve partnered with some of the world’s most ambitious organisations to deliver large, complex Drupal projects like the Welsh Government and ORX. We understand the challenges non-profits face — from budget constraints to compliance needs and engaging diverse audiences.

Our approach combines technical excellence with a deep empathy for your mission. Together, we can unlock Drupal’s full potential to help you achieve digital transformation that drives measurable impact.

Ready to explore what’s possible?

If you’re looking for a secure, scalable, and cost-effective platform that empowers your organisation to connect, engage, and grow, Drupal is the ideal choice.

Talk to our Drupal experts today and let’s build a platform that amplifies your mission.

Or call 020 7439 1900

Joe Pilgrim

Principal Product Owner

Joe brings over a decade of experience leading product teams across complex digital transformation projects. At Box UK, he helps organisations turn ambitious ideas into actionable product strategies that deliver measurable results—balancing user needs, stakeholder goals, and technical realities to drive long-term success.

Want to chat more about how we can help?

Get in touch to book your free consultation with our expert team.

This field is hidden when viewing the form

You may withdraw this permission at any time. All information will be processed in accordance with our privacy policy and will never be sold on.

This field is for validation purposes and should be left unchanged.

You might also be interested in…